Adding items to a composite structure diagram
You can add an existing item to a Composite Structure Diagram in the following ways:
Dragging items from a Modeler pane to the Composite Structure Diagram.
Through a Structure Diagram toolbar button.
Through the diagram background.
You can add existing items and links to a Composite Structure Diagram in the following ways:
Through populate commands available on the diagram background and symbols.

To drag an item to a composite structure diagram:
1. Open the Composite Structure Diagram.
2. In an appropriate pane, locate the item you want to add to the Composite Structure Diagram.
3. Drag the item from the appropriate pane to the Composite Structure Diagram.
To add an item through a composite structure diagram toolbar button:
1. Open the Composite Structure Diagram.
2. On the Composite Structure Diagram's toolbar, click the appropriate button for the item you want to add, and then on the diagram, right-click the diagram background.
3. From the Select Object dialog, select the item you want to add to the diagram.
To add items and links through the populate commands:
Right-click the diagram background, point to Populate, and then click the appropriate command.
or
Right-click the diagram symbol you want to populate, point to Populate, and then click the appropriate command.
Use the Parts and Ports commands to populate Parts and Ports.
If you populate a link type and the linked item does not appear on the Composite Structure Diagram, Modeler adds the linked item to the diagram.
